Metro (TSX:MRU) Valuation Update After Supply Chain Setback and Earnings Impact

Metro (TSX:MRU) recently announced a $22-million after-tax impact on its fourth quarter earnings. This resulted from a mechanical failure at its Toronto frozen food distribution centre, which is part of the company’s ongoing supply chain upgrades.

Metro’s recent earnings hit comes as the company maintains its quarterly dividend and works to resolve the supply chain issue in Toronto. Even with short-term headwinds, momentum looks intact. After a dip over the past few months, Metro’s one-year total shareholder return of nearly 13% signals underlying strength, while the five-year total return stands just under 60%.

Most Popular Narrative: 11.7% Undervalued

With Metro closing at CA$93.54, the most followed narrative suggests shares are around 12% below its calculated fair value of CA$105.91. This creates an intriguing gap between price and expectations, raising the stakes for Metro's growth story.

The company's ongoing investments in store modernization and network expansion, including new store openings, major renovations, and upgrades, position Metro to capitalize on Canada's urbanization and population growth, supporting higher long-term sales volumes and top-line revenue growth.

However, rising competition from discount grocers and inflation-driven cost increases may challenge Metro’s margins and put pressure on its longer-term growth outlook.
